The O2 Arena Prague will continue to hold the name of the telecoms giant after venue owner Bestsport extended their partnership for another five years.

The O2 Arena Prague said both the O2 Arena and O2 Universum will carry on under the name of the largest operator in the Czech Republic.

The 20,000 capacity O2 Arena is a multi-purpose arena, in Prague, Czech Republic. It is home to HC Sparta Prague of the Czech Extraliga and is the third-largest ice hockey arena in Europe.

Robert Schaffer, director of Bestsport, which owns both halls, said, “O2 arena has been named after the largest mobile operator in the Czech Republic for the sixteenth year, and I am very pleased that it will remain so until at least 2029.

“Our long-term goal is to bring the most interesting program possible, which will attract the largest possible number of visitors every year.

“I see O2’s interest in continuing the cooperation as proof that we are succeeding in achieving this goal, and at the same time as a great commitment to continue maintaining this cooperation at a mutually beneficial level.”

The conclusion of the contract does not only affect the name of the hall. There will be benefits for visitors, especially for O2 customers.

These will include priority ticket purchase, faster entrance to the venue or the possibility of reserving parking.

As an entertainment and sports center, the O2 arena and O2 Universum host approximately 160 events every year. From concerts by world-famous artists to entertaining stand-up shows, to major sporting events.

Hany Farghali, Director of Corporate Communications and CSR at O2, said, “We will gradually bring our customers a number of unique innovations that will make them feel exceptional. We are already expanding the option of priority ticket purchase in the Moje O2 application, where in the future we will also launch priority reservation of parking spaces or upgrade tickets to the club floor.

“We are also gradually introducing discounts on products and services in the vicinity of the O2 Arena, such as the 10% discount on overnight stays at STAGES HOTEL Prague, which is already active.

“Next year, we also plan to introduce a special “fast track”, thanks to which our customers will avoid queues when entering the hall. In short, they will receive benefits that they will not find elsewhere.”

In 2024, O2, in cooperation with CETIN, carried out a complete replacement of mobile technology in the O2 Arena.

Thanks to the enhanced speed and capacity of the mobile network, this hall is now undoubtedly the best-covered sports venue in the Czech Republic.

Since May, 20 new technological “nests” have been operating at the venue, which, with the help of 70 antennas, ensure top-notch mobile and data traffic.
